Meet Michael J Foxface.

c01630bb39672002be82b983db713015.jpg


Had her since December 7th, completed 7 weeks of QT and has been in 180 gallon DT for ~3 weeks.

I have a couple questions-

1) she is supposed to be a herbivore, but hasn’t touched any offerings of Nori or lettuce. Tried every couple days in DT and she just ignores it. She is, however, crazy for marine cuisine, mysis and spirulina gut loaded brine shrimp mixed with selcon and formula 1 pellets.

Is there anything I should be supplementing in place of the veggies?

2) she seems to flash her dorsal fins *a lot*. I think she even scares *herself* sometimes when she catches a reflection. Doesn’t flash them at the clowns or the Randall’s goby but whenever someone gets close (other than me- I deliver the tasty meat snacks so I’m good) she’ll do it. Doesn’t change colors or swim off, just sits there flicking her dorsal fin.

Normal at this point and expect it to become more infrequent as she calms down?

Water parameters are testing normal-
Ammonia zero
Nitrite zero
Nitrate 0-3ppm
Phosphate 0.05ppm
Temp 78oF
Salinity 1.023

Your rocks look pretty clean. If they had some algae on them, you would see her feeding upon it. I always add some frozen seaweed cubes in with the fish "smoothie" I feed my fish.

Zoecon contains more essentials from sponges, etc. and is usually used to help fish suffering from HLLE. I alternate between Selcon and Zoecon to try to make up for the natural foods my fish are missing.
